For electrical risk lockout and mechanical risk lockout applications
- Personal lockout kits come with keyed alike padlocks, allowing all the locks to be opened with a single key
- These kits are designed to be used by a single employee
- The personal valve and electrical lockout kit from Brady provides everything you need to lockout breakers, plugs and valves of various types and sizes
- Lockout toolbox is made of durable co-polymer resin and includes a removable organizer tray
- Assigning keyed alike padlocks to each employee simplifies key management and ensures that employees can quickly and easily find the right key
- Remember, to comply with safety requirements, a set of keyed alike padlocks should never be split among multiple employees
